Output 8a626d5281997ced559a1de8252ec027da981af37786b331edb4624a6faa3779:0

value
7458750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d26198cee530559b48fc036a8017a910c39efa9 OP_EQUAL
address
3LPk66AuMDVkomk32MhY7SDXRnCbXSpSwC
transaction
8a626d5281997ced559a1de8252ec027da981af37786b331edb4624a6faa3779
spent
true